Nice article in Hana Hou magazine about the revival of Lyon Arboretum, a legendary but until recently ramshackle botanical garden on Oahu near downtown Honolulu and run by the University of Hawaii (caveat emptor -- I was married here at inspiration point seven years ago). The garden is now more handicapped accessible and many of the broken-down paths have been fixed up. Docent-led tours are among the best in the islands in terms of biological data dump impact. The Arboretum itself is breathtaking, set on a verdant hillside in the far reaches of a massive mountain-ringed valley. Go visit.
